Before human intervention in the hydraulic system, the upstream area of \u200b\u200bthe marshes was periodically flooded during floods. Conversely, during drought periods, the area of \u200b\u200bthe flooded areas decreased, causing a succession in the behavior of wetlands, which generally helped in the development of biodiversity and the improvement of environmental conditions to the maximum extent: the variation of flood extension and water depth creates favorable conditions for plants and animals. Moreover, there are no dams and barriers made by man under natural conditions. Consequently, there was less real constraint on the extent of inundation, except for natural levees and gradual changes in terrain elevation. The peaks of large flows entering these wetlands and flooding were naturally mitigated as the water spread across the floodplains. The large volumes of water moving through the wetlands helped maintain a high level of connectivity between the marshes and the various rivers.<\/span><\/strong><\/span><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Flood Dynamics in the Marshes &#8211; Natural Conditions Zaid Hakim Jiyad Under the supervision of Lect.
